大学生如何从入门到精通计算机科学

目录

引言:

第一部分:了解计算机科学的基础知识

第二部分:选择适合自己的学习方式

第三部分:参加实践项目

1. 参加校内的计算机科学项目

2. 参加开源社区项目

3. 自己开发一个项目

第四部分:不断学习和探索

1. 书籍推荐

2. 方法指导


引言:

计算机科学是当今社会中最热门的学科之一。随着计算机技术的快速发展,计算机科学的应用范围越来越广泛,成为现代社会的重要组成部分。对于大学生来说,学习计算机科学是非常重要的,因为它可以帮助他们更好地适应未来的职业发展。本文将从四个部分介绍如何学习计算机科学。

第一部分:了解计算机科学的基础知识

在学习计算机科学之前,需要了解一些基础知识,这样才能更好地理解计算机科学的概念和应用。首先,需要了解计算机硬件的基本组成部分,如CPU、内存、硬盘、显卡等,并讲解它们的功能和作用。同时,需要了解计算机软件方面的知识,如操作系统、编程语言、数据库等方面的内容。对于操作系统,需要了解不同类型的操作系统、操作系统的功能和作用,以及操作系统的发展历程。对于编程语言,需要了解常见的编程语言、编程语言的特点和应用场景等。对于数据库,需要了解数据库的基本概念、不同类型的数据库、数据库的应用场景等。

第二部分:选择适合自己的学习方式

在学习计算机科学的过程中,需要选择适合自己的学习方式。有些人喜欢通过阅读书籍来学习,而有些人则喜欢通过参加培训班或者线上课程来学习。对于大学生来说,可以通过参加计算机科学的课程来学习,或者通过自学来学习。如果选择自学的方式,可以通过阅读计算机科学的书籍、观看在线视频以及参加在线社区等方式来学习。

第三部分:参加实践项目

学习计算机科学不仅需要理论知识,还需要实践能力。通过参加实践项目,可以将理论知识应用到实际项目中,提高自己的实践能力。可以通过参加校内的计算机科学项目、参加开源社区项目或者自己开发一个项目来提高实践能力。好的,关于参加实践项目部分,我可以提供一些具体的例子和操作步骤。

1. 参加校内的计算机科学项目

大学通常会有一些计算机科学相关的项目,例如参加学校的科研项目或者参加学生俱乐部的项目等。这些项目可以帮助学生更好地掌握计算机科学的知识和技能,并且提高团队协作能力。具体操作步骤如下:

- 了解学校的计算机科学项目,例如参加学校的科研项目或者参加学生俱乐部的项目等。

- 选择自己感兴趣的项目,并与项目组织者联系。

- 参加项目的培训和讲座,了解项目的目标和要求。

- 参与项目的开发和实现,并与团队成员合作完成任务。

2. 参加开源社区项目

开源社区是一个非常好的学习计算机科学的平台,学生可以通过参与开源社区项目来提高自己的实践能力。具体操作步骤如下:

- 了解开源社区项目,例如GitHub、GitLab等。

- 选择自己感兴趣的项目,并与项目负责人联系。

- 阅读项目的文档和代码,了解项目的目标和要求。

- 参与项目的开发和实现,并与社区成员合作完成任务。

3. 自己开发一个项目

自己开发一个项目是一个非常好的学习计算机科学的方式,可以帮助学生更好地掌握计算机科学的知识和技能,并且提高自己的实践能力。具体操作步骤如下:

- 选择一个自己感兴趣的项目,并确定项目的目标和要求。

- 设计项目的架构和功能,并编写代码实现功能。

- 测试和调试项目,并解决可能出现的问题。

- 发布项目,并与其他开发者交流和分享经验。

总之,参加实践项目是学习计算机科学的重要方式之一,可以帮助学生更好地掌握计算机科学的知识和技能,并提高实践能力。具体操作步骤包括了解项目、选择项目、参与项目开发和实现等。

第四部分:不断学习和探索

计算机科学是一个广泛而深奥的学科,需要不断学习和探索。在学习计算机科学的过程中,需要保持学习的热情,不断探索新的知识和技术。可以通过参加学术会议、阅读学术论文、参加技术交流会等方式来了解最新的技术和发展趋势。好的,下面提供一些有用的书籍和方法指导,帮助大学生不断学习和探索计算机科学。

计算机科学是一个不断更新和发展的领域,因此学习计算机科学需要不断实践和学习。在学习的过程中,需要经常练习编程和实验操作系统等技能。同时,还需要关注最新的技术动态和研究成果,了解最新的计算机科学发展趋势。

以下是几个建议:

  1. 经常写代码。编程是计算机科学最基本的技能之一,需要经常练习才能熟练掌握。可以从简单的项目开始,逐渐提高难度。

  2. 参加技术交流活动。可以参加学术会议、技术论坛、黑客马拉松等活动,了解最新的技术动态和交流经验。

  3. 关注开源项目。开源项目是计算机科学中非常重要的一部分,通过关注开源项目可以了解最新的技术趋势和研究成果。

  4. 学习新技术。不断学习新技术是非常重要的,可以通过阅读最新的论文、学习最新的编程语言和框架等方式来学习。

  5. 实践操作系统。操作系统是计算机科学中非常重要的一部分,可以通过自己安装和配置操作系统来提高自己的操作系统技能。

1. 书籍推荐

- 《计算机程序的构造和解释》:这是一本经典的计算机科学教材,可以帮助学生深入了解计算机程序的构造和解释。

- 《算法导论》:这是一本非常经典的算法教材,可以帮助学生深入了解算法的设计和分析。

- 《深入理解计算机系统》:这是一本非常实用的计算机科学教材,可以帮助学生深入了解计算机系统的组成和运行原理。

- 《编程珠玑》:这是一本非常实用的编程教材,可以帮助学生学习如何解决实际问题和优化代码。

- 《代码大全》:这是一本非常实用的软件开发教材,可以帮助学生学习如何编写高质量的代码。

2. 方法指导

- 阅读学术论文:学术论文是了解最新计算机科学技术和发展趋势的重要途径。学生可以定期阅读计算机科学领域的学术论文,以了解最新的技术和发展趋势。

- 参加技术交流会:技术交流会是了解最新计算机科学技术和发展趋势的重要途径。学生可以参加各种技术交流会,与其他开发者交流和分享经验。

- 参加在线社区:在线社区是了解最新计算机科学技术和发展趋势的重要途径。学生可以参加各种在线社区,与其他开发者交流和分享经验。

- 参加项目开发:参加项目开发是提高实践能力的重要途径。学生可以参加各种开源项目或者自己开发一个项目,以提高实践能力。

- 学习新技术:学习新技术是不断学习和探索的重要途径。学生可以学习新的编程语言、框架、工具等,以拓展自己的技术栈。

总之,不断学习和探索是学习计算机科学的重要方式之一。通过阅读书籍、参加技术交流会、参加在线社区、参加项目开发和学习新技术等方式,可以帮助学生不断学习和探索计算机科学。

总之,学习计算机科学需要具备一定的基础知识,选择适合自己的学习方式,参加实践项目,并不断学习和探索。希望本文可以为大学生们提供一些学习计算机科学的方法和技巧,帮助他们更好地学习计算机科学。

猜你喜欢

转载自blog.csdn.net/m0_73421035/article/details/129761639